http://www.vanityfair.com/politics/2013/04/sandra-day-oconnor-guns-assault-weapons

[font size=5]Out to Lunch with Sandra Day O’Connor
The first woman on the Supreme Court talks theatrics, guns, and prairie oysters[/font].

By John Heilpern

.... She became a feminist icon upon her appointment to the Supreme Court in 1981—but does that make her a feminist? “It makes me an old lady,” she replied, and laughed. ....

“Living as I do in a city today, I have no occasion to use a gun—none. So, I don’t keep one.” ....

She decorously resists second-guessing the judgments of today’s Supreme Court. But when I asked if she thought it necessary for the general public to own assault weapons, she responded unequivocally: “I do not see the need for a resident of the United States to have an assault weapon.” ....
